The idea for NanoLook AI came from a frustrating trend: every time someone uses a generic AI generator for a LinkedIn picture, it returns a hyper-airbrushed, plastic-looking avatar. Elite recruiters and clients can spot those from a mile away, and they completely ruin your professional credibility. We wanted to build a practical middle ground between a casual phone selfie and a $5,000 professional studio shoot. With NanoLook AI, our goal is **"credible polish"**. We built a reconstruction engine that explicitly preserves your natural skin textures, pores, and unique facial identity—ensuring you actually look like *you*, just on your very best day. Here is what makes NanoLook AI different: 🚫 No Plastic Faces: We reject the artificial, smoothed-out look to maintain real human textures. ⚡ Zero-Prompt Style Engine: You don't need to learn prompt engineering. Just tap a style like The Executive, Old Money, Corporate Baddie, or Creative Maverick to change your vibe instantly. 📐 Avatar-Optimized Framing: Our composition engine crops and frames your headshots specifically to stand out in small, circular social media profiles. 🛡️ Privacy-First: Your data belongs to you. We handle all uploads with strict privacy protocols and automatic deletion policies. Whether you are a job seeker, a founder, or a freelancer, we’d love for you to give it a spin.
